On the Monday Night Club, ex-Premier League striker Chris Sutton discussed the controversy surrounding Liverpool winning goal against Nottingham Forest. Sutton raised doubts about whether the officiating complaints were a way for Nottingham Forest to divert attention from their own shortcomings.
He suggested that rather than blaming others, it would be beneficial for Forest to address their players’ failure to clear the ball during the game. Sutton expressed skepticism stating that Forest is likely to place blame elsewhere instead of holding their own players accountable.
